Job Description

The Clinical Research Lead (CRL) is responsible for the management of clinical sites being considered and/or participating in Lilly clinical trials for the assigned therapeutic areas(s), while driving to an unparalleled clinical trial/customer experience

  • Is responsible for site identification and qualification.

  • Accountable for comprehensive site management activities to ensure timely delivery of enrolment readiness, trial recruitment/enrolment and database locks; inclusive of performance management and issue mitigation, identification and resolution

  • Ensures site and country-level inspection readiness at all times

  • Responsible for understanding local treatment paradigms and standard of care to support targeted feasibility and strategic allocation of trials as required

  • Provide vendor oversight for site monitoring activities at site/country level

  • Establishes and develops strong professional relationships with active/potential clinical investigators to expand/maintain clinical research partnership opportunities and provide an unparalleled experience for participation in Lilly clinical trials.

  • Accountable for the development of strategic institutional/site relationships to optimize the delivery of clinical trial programs; including across therapeutic areas where applicable

  • Travel required (50-75%)
